I will summarize my question first, for those that don't want to read all the details. Is there ANY way, any registry hack, to stop Outlook 2010 from wiping out shortcuts to online links such as Dynamics CRM, if I launch Outlook off line?

I'm a Microsoft Dynamics CRM user and one of the most awesome things is that the Shortcust area of Outlook allows me to create one single view of all of my high priority views, including linking to Dynamics CRM entities. The problem is that I frequently need to work disconnected and due to the way Outlook works, it simply wipes every shortcut to anything it can't connect to when it is launched. Evidently it's been this way for years and MS does not see any reason to fix it???

There used to be some workarounds such as this excellent one but unfortunately MS seems to have pulled a bad joke on us and broken this about 4 different ways with CRM 2011. To summarize:

1. If you add Dynamic CRM folders to the shortcuts ares of Outlook they get automatically deleted if you launch Outlook while offline and cannot connect to CRM.

2. The fix explained in the link above now won't work because the URL's to the Dynamics CRM 2011 get rejected by Outlook and the user is told "the URL us too long".

3. There is another fix here which I mention just in case someone refer me to it as an answer, it tells you how to add Dynamics CRM to favorite folders, that fix is now also broken, for the same reason as #1 above - all your favorites get wiped out if you launch offline and cannnot connect to CRM.

Many thanks if anyone has a solution!

I'm not real familiar with how CRM works with outlook, but unless you use a different profile, the links shouldn't be removed. You could copy the navigation pane xml file and use a batch file to copy it back after working offline - but if you make any changes, you'll need to make a new copy. Actually, you could use a bat to make the copy and one to copy it back...

The navpane file is here: %USERPROFILE%\AppData\Roaming\Microsoft\Outlook in vista and win7. Use a batch to copy account_name.xml to a new location and one to copy it to that location. You can even start Outlook from the batch file - make a shortcut called Online CRM and use it when you are working online after having worked offline.

Cool, glad it worked. That file controls the entire navigation pane. This is more than the shortcuts on the Shortcut pane - it also holds the Favorites at the top of the mail list and rearranged folders or groups created on other panes (My Contacts, My Calendar, My Tasks groups). Any changes made to any of the panes you see when you click the buttons at the bottom of the navigation pane are stored in the file. If you add some folders to the folder list above Mail, you'll need a new copy of the xml.
